Bonds Party Like It's 1949
After the brief uptick in interest rates in March, many are asking if the bond party is over. Certainly we are entering the last phase of an almost 30 year bull market in bonds, reasonably illustrated by the following chart, which tracks the 10 Year Treasury rate since 1960. Go further back and the end of the last bond bull market was around 1949.
